Lower court

The phrase lower court has several possible meanings in English:

  • In reference to an appeal, the lower court is the court whose decision is being reviewed. The lower court, in this relative sense, may be a trial court or may itself be an appellate court that is lower in rank than the reviewing court.

  • In an absolute sense, lower court refers to a trial court as opposed to an appellate court.

  • As among trial courts, a lower court is a court of limited jurisdiction, especially one that is limited to hearing minor offenses or small civil disputes, as opposed to a superior court.
